Interleukin 1 receptor-associated kinase 1 (IRAK1) mutation is a common, essential driver for Kaposi sarcoma herpesvirus lymphoma

Abstract: Significance Primary effusion lymphoma (PEL) is an AIDS-defining cancer. It is associated with Kaposi sarcoma-associated herpesvirus. To date, no sequencing studies have been conducted for this cancer. We used X chromosome-targeted next-generation sequencing to identify 33 genes with coding region mutations in 100% of cases, including in interleukin 1 receptor-associated kinase 1 (IRAK1). IRAK1 kinase modulates toll-like receptor signaling-mediated immune signaling. It binds to MyD88 adapter protein,… Show more

“…The upregulation of IRAK1 may cause an increased level of IRAK1 expression in HCC, as confirmed by our results. As for the missense mutation of IRAK1, a Phe196Ser change in IRAK1 was detected in primary effusion lymphoma (PEL),31 which caused the constitutive phosphorylation of IRAK1 in PEL and promoted the progression of PEL. We postulated that the specific missense mutation of IRAK1 existed in HCC to facilitate the development of IRAK1 via the phosphorylation of IRAK1.…”

“…Rather, the KSHV viral protein LANA drives MYC overexpression (143,144). Comparative genome hybridization uncovered fragile histidine triad (FHIT) deletion as overrepresented in PELs, and targeted sequencing studies identified a polymorphism in IL-1 receptor-associated kinase 1 (IRAK1) as significantly overrepresented in PELs (145,146). Moreover, IRAK1 signaling is required for PEL growth.…”
